Originally Posted by kiltro
Looks awesome. That's the stance I want to achieve with mu truck. are you lifted?
I'm scared of getting 285/75/16 without a lift.
I am stock height with a t-bar crank to level out. I had to remove the front mud flaps, but other then that they fit great, I get a little tiny rub at full lock on the sway bar, and if I flex to the bump stops I get a little rub in the rear.
